quercifolia variety (Oakleaf Hydrangea) Can thrive in dryer locations than its cousins Does not like wet feet Needs little maintenance Blooms on old wood - prune immediately after flowering Blooms in Summer arborescens varieties (Smooth hydrangea) Average soil Flowers are great for winter interest Prune back to 12 in spring. Blooms in Summer Blooms best in full sun to partial shade macrophylla and serrata varieties (mophead, bigleaf hydrangea, lacecap hydrangea) Moist soils Avoid late afternoon sun. Stems often die to the ground in winter, but all our varieties bloom on new growth. Prune in spring. Mid-day sun for best blooming.
paniculata varieties (panicle hydrangea) Large, cone-shaped flower clusters from summer through fall.
